Ildar S. Minniakhmetov is a researcher focused on agricultural robotics and precision farming, with a particular emphasis on automation for fertigation-based systems. His most-cited work, "Design and Development of Autonomous Pesticide Sprayer Robot for Fertigation Farm" (2020, 28 citations), addresses a critical gap in Malaysian agriculture: while fertigation farms excel in irrigation and fertilization, they lack integrated pest management solutions. Minniakhmetov’s major contribution lies in designing an autonomous robot that navigates crop rows to apply pesticides precisely, reducing human exposure and chemical waste. This work demonstrates his commitment to bridging automation with practical agricultural challenges.
